WebJul 23, 2024 · Perhaps the best thing you learn in culinary school is having your mise en place—everything in its place. It’s the best way to stay calm in a professional kitchen. Professional cooks spend hours chopping up meats, vegetables and herbs so they’re ready to add to the pan when they need them.

Tip the pan … cs7400iawWebApr 13, 2024 · 1 Cabernet Sauvignon Cabernet sauvignon is one of the most popular reds in the world for a reason. It's a dry wine with a rich, full flavor that pairs just as perfectly with a hearty steak dinner as it does with pork and grilled lamb chops. Consider it a safe choice of red wine for dinner parties and gifting.
